agreed Alfred Ossonga and the Choir have done a great job over the years. But it is not true that no other EA Catholic choirs who never recorded earlier than that. For example, we have Kwaya ya Mt. Cecilia Mwenge, Dar-es-salaam, who recorded the classical Nyimbo za Bikira Maria albums from 1988, and have continued to do so to-date.
We have another Tanzanian Choir, Kwaya Kuu ya Mt. Cecilia, Arusha, who have great songs too, among them Nimeonja Pendo lako, Nikiziangalia mbingu etc recorded long ago, around late 90s.
We have other beautiful songs from St. Benedicts parish Choir, Ruaraka, led by Mike Maganzo (Their samples are not online coz most of their songs are Audio)
